 Milan prosecutor Francesca Crupi asked for a 30-year sentence for Marco Venturi, 45, accused of voluntary murder for killing his girlfriend Carlotta Benusiglio, a 37-year-old designer who was found hanged with a scarf from a tree in the gardens of the square Naples, in Milan, on the night of May 31, 2016. Three times, by the investigating judge, Riesame and Cassazione, the request for arrest was rejected for the man, accused in abbreviated form before the magistrate Raffaella Mascarino also for stalking and injuries to damage of the partner.

An expert in the investigation phase established that it would be suicide.
